jenkins 部署聚合工程的时候 打不进去 父项目的jar包

Bertha 。 2022-05-30 12:13 258阅读 0赞
  1. <build>
  2. <!--
  3. <resources>
  4. <resource>
  5. <directory>src/main/java</directory>
  6. <includes>
  7. <include>**/*.xml</include>
  8. </includes>
  9. <filtering>true</filtering>
  10. </resource>
  11. </resources>
  12. -->
  13. <plugins>
  14. <!-- 解决 SpringBoot 不继承父 parent 打包不包含依赖的问题 -->
  15. <plugin>
  16. <groupId>org.springframework.boot</groupId>
  17. <artifactId>spring-boot-maven-plugin</artifactId>
  18. <configuration>
  19. <mainClass>com.ahies.itsm.system.permission.SystemPermissionApplication</mainClass>
  20. </configuration>
  21. <executions>
  22. <execution>
  23. <goals>
  24. <goal>repackage</goal>
  25. </goals>
  26. </execution>
  27. </executions>
  28. </plugin>
  29. <plugin>
  30. <groupId>org.apache.maven.plugins</groupId>
  31. <artifactId>maven-source-plugin</artifactId>
  32. <version>2.2.1</version>
  33. <executions>
  34. <execution>
  35. <phase>package</phase>
  36. <goals>
  37. <goal>jar</goal>
  38. </goals>
  39. </execution>
  40. </executions>
  41. </plugin>
  42. <plugin>
  43. <groupId>org.apache.maven.plugins</groupId>
  44. <artifactId>maven-deploy-plugin</artifactId>
  45. <version>2.7</version>
  46. <configuration>
  47. <updateReleaseInfo>true</updateReleaseInfo>
  48. </configuration>
  49. </plugin>
  50. <plugin>
  51. <groupId>org.apache.maven.plugins</groupId>
  52. <artifactId>maven-release-plugin</artifactId>
  53. <version>2.4.1</version>
  54. </plugin>
  55. <plugin>
  56. <groupId>org.apache.maven.plugins</groupId>
  57. <artifactId>maven-compiler-plugin</artifactId>
  58. <configuration>
  59. <source>1.6</source>
  60. <target>1.6</target>
  61. </configuration>
  62. </plugin>
  63. </plugins>
  64. </build>

发表评论

表情:
评论列表 (有 0 条评论,258人围观)

还没有评论,来说两句吧...

相关阅读